The lithograph is very vibrant in color; once framed, most of the imperfections will be barely visible. Sold as presented. Henri Rivière (1864-1951) was a French painter, engraver, and illustrator. He began his career with drawing, then moved on to intaglio engraving, specifically etching, in 1882. Simultaneously, in 1886, he embarked on a career as a director and set designer, creating shadow puppet theater at the Chat Noir cabaret, enhancing these shows with innovative, colorful sets. He then devoted himself exclusively to painting and engraving, establishing himself in the history of etching, printmaking, wood engraving, lithography, and watercolor (he painted approximately a thousand watercolors).
